MySQL Abfrage auf Webseite (Branchenbuch)

intramat

Grünschnabel
Hallo zusammen,

ich hab da mal ein Problem

Ich soll eine Art Branchensuche auf einer HP machen. Ich habe eine MySQL Datenbank mit zwei Tabellen.

tb_branche (id, branche)
tb_adressen(id,branche,firmenname,name,vorname,plz,ort usw.)

Man soll in einem Pulldownmenü (weil es ca. 90 Branchen sind) auswählen können. Danach sollen darunter die Treffer angezeigt werden. Die Treffer sollen verlinkt sein, damit man auf eine Detailseite kommt, wo eventuell noch Bilder erscheinen (Firmenlogo, Produktfotos usw.)

Ich weiß, daß das ziemlich viel auf einmal ist, aber ich raff es einfach nicht
Ich hab schon wie ein Wilder "gegoogelt", aber irgendwie nie das richtige gefunden.

Ist da jemand, der so was ähnliches schon mal gemacht hat.

Grüße
Manfred
 
-

Hallo!

Leider seh ich nicht ganz wo dein Problem liegt!

Weisst du nicht wie du auf die DB zugreiffen must? Oder wie du über ein Dropdown-Feld die ausgewählte Sparte auf der DB abfragst?

Bitte schildere dein Problem doch etwas genauer und falls du schon was gebastelt hast, dann leg doch bitte dein Sourcecode dazu!

Gruss
{snowrider}
 
Hallo,

ich weiß wie man ein Formular bastelt und ich weiß wie man Dropdownmemüs baut.

Ich krieg es nicht hin, daß wenn ein Menüpunkt gewählt, ist die Treffer ausgegeben werden.

Hier ist der Code, ich hoffe man kann was damit anfangen:

<?php require_once('Connections/HGV.php'); ?>
<?php
mysql_select_db($database_HGV, $HGV);
$query_auswahl = "SELECT tb_branchen.branche FROM tb_branchen ORDER BY tb_branchen.branche";
$auswahl = mysql_query($query_auswahl, $HGV) or die(mysql_error());
$row_auswahl = mysql_fetch_assoc($auswahl);
$totalRows_auswahl = mysql_num_rows($auswahl);
?>
<html>
<head>
<title>Unbenanntes Dokument</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
</head>

<body>
<table width="75%" height="49" border="1" align="center" cellpadding="0" cellspacing="0">
<tr>
<td height="21" colspan="2" bgcolor="#FFFFFF"><font face="Verdana, Arial, Times New Roman">Branche
ausw&auml;hlen:</font></td>
</tr>
<tr>
<td width="49%" height="26">
<form name="form1" method="post" action="ausgabe.php">
<select name="select">
<?php
do {
?>
<option value="<?php echo $row_auswahl['branche']?>"><?php echo $row_auswahl['branche']?></option>
<?php
} while ($row_auswahl = mysql_fetch_assoc($auswahl));
$rows = mysql_num_rows($auswahl);
if($rows > 0) {
mysql_data_seek($auswahl, 0);
$row_auswahl = mysql_fetch_assoc($auswahl);
}
?>
</select>
<input type="submit" name="Submit" value="Ausw&auml;hlen">
</form></td>
<td width="51%">&nbsp;</td>
</tr>
</table>
</body>
</html>
<?php
mysql_free_result($auswahl);
?>

Wie muß jetzt die Datei "ausgabe.php" aussehen ?
 
Zurück